This guide breaks these sophisticated approaches into simple, actionable steps that any serious trader can implement. ## Why Most Bitcoin Price Predictions Fail The cryptocurrency market is notorious for wild price swings, with **Bitcoin's 30-day volatility averaging 60-80% annually** compared to roughly 15% for the S&P 500. This extreme volatility creates both opportunity and trapdoors for predictors. ### The Single-Indicator Trap Most failed predictions stem from over-reliance on one data type. A trader might spot a **golden cross on the 50/200-day moving average** and go all-in, ignoring that on-chain exchange inflows just spiked 40%—often a precursor to selling pressure. Similarly, **social media sentiment analysis** might flash bullish while futures funding rates show excessive leverage and crowded positioning. ### Recency Bias and Narrative Fallacy Human psychology compounds these errors. After a 20% weekly gain, traders extrapolate linearly rather than recognizing mean-reversion tendencies. No single pillar dominates; weightings shift with market regime. ### Pillar 1: On-Chain Intelligence **Blockchain data provides unique, tamper-proof insights** unavailable in traditional markets. Key metrics include: | Metric | What It Measures | Bullish Signal | Bearish Signal | |--------|-----------------|--------------|--------------| | **Exchange Reserves** | BTC held on exchanges | Declining (holders moving off) | Rising (preparing to sell) | | **MVRV Ratio** | Market cap vs. realized cap | Below 1.0 (undervalued) | Above 3.5 (overvalued) | | **SOPR** | Spent Output Profit Ratio | <1.0 (selling at loss, capitulation) | >1.0 consistently (profit-taking) | | **Active Addresses** | Daily unique transactors | Sustained growth | Sharp decline | | **Whale Wallet Movements** | Large-holder transactions | Accumulation patterns | Distribution to exchanges | The **MVRV ratio** has historically marked cycle tops above 3.5 and bottoms below 1.0. In December 2024, with Bitcoin near $108,000, MVRV exceeded 2.8—elevated but not extreme by historical bubble standards. ### Pillar 2: Derivatives and Market Structure Futures, options, and perpetual swaps reveal **sophisticated trader positioning and expectations**: - **Funding rates**: Perpetual swap funding above 0.01% per 8-hour period indicates long-heavy leverage; sustained negative funding suggests shorts dominate - **Open interest**: Rising OI with flat price = potential volatility expansion; declining OI with falling price = liquidated leverage, potential bottoming - **Options skew**: 25-delta risk reversal shows whether calls or puts trade at premium; extreme skew often precedes reversals - **Liquidation clusters**: Concentrated leverage levels become magnetic price targets During the March 2024 rally to new all-time highs, **funding rates exceeded 0.1% daily** on major exchanges—an unsustainable level that preceded a 15% correction within 72 hours. ### Pillar 3: Macroeconomic and Cross-Asset Context Bitcoin increasingly trades as a **risk-on macro asset** correlated with tech equities and liquidity conditions: 1. **Federal Reserve policy**: Rate cuts and quantitative easing expand money supply; hikes contract it. The September 2024 50-basis-point cut catalyzed a 12% Bitcoin surge. 2. **Dollar strength**: DXY above 105 historically pressures BTC; sustained weakness below 100 supports rallies. 3. **Real yields**: 10-year TIPS yields above 2% reduce Bitcoin's relative attractiveness as a non-yielding asset. 4. **Geopolitical stress**: Moderate escalation (Ukraine, Middle East) often boosts BTC initially; resolution of uncertainty can trigger profit-taking. ### Pillar 4: Prediction Market Probabilities **Prediction markets aggregate distributed intelligence** with financial skin in the game. Our [Algorithmic Market Making on Prediction Markets Using PredictEngine](/blog/algorithmic-market-making-on-prediction-markets-using-predictengine) explores how algorithmic approaches can maintain consistent exposure while managing risk. ## Risk Management: The Prediction Multiplier Even accurate predictions fail without proper **position sizing and risk controls**. A 60% win rate with 2:1 reward-to-risk generates substantial returns; the same win rate with 0.8:1 ratio destroys capital. ### The Kelly Criterion and Practical Fractional Kelly The Kelly formula calculates optimal bet sizing: **f* = (bp - q) / b**, where b = odds, p = win probability, q = loss probability. For Bitcoin predictions with 55% confidence and 2:1 payoff, full Kelly suggests 10% position sizing; most professionals use **quarter-Kelly (2.5%)** to reduce volatility. ### Correlation Awareness Bitcoin's correlation with **Nasdaq-100 has averaged 0.45 since 2022**, spiking to 0.70 during stress events. A "diversified" crypto portfolio often provides no true diversification. No single method dominates consistently; **ensemble approaches combining on-chain data, derivatives metrics, and macro context** outperform any individual technique. Accuracy varies by timeframe, with short-term prediction market probabilities often achieving 65-70% calibration versus 55-60% for pure technical analysis. The key is measuring and updating your own prediction track record to identify which methods work for your specific approach. ### How do prediction markets improve Bitcoin forecasting? Most successful predictors specialize in one timeframe rather than attempting all three, as edge and required skills differ substantially. ### How much capital do I need for serious Bitcoin prediction trading? **Minimum viable capital depends on fee structure and risk tolerance**. For spot Bitcoin with 1% position sizing and $10 stop-losses, $5,000-$10,000 allows meaningful learning. Prediction markets often permit smaller experiments—$500-$1,000 suffices for strategy development. Never risk capital you cannot afford to lose completely; prediction accuracy improves over hundreds of trials, requiring capital preservation through inevitable wrong calls. ### How do I avoid emotional decision-making in Bitcoin trading? **Systematize every decision point**: pre-define entry criteria, position sizes, and exit conditions before any trade. Use **prediction journals** recording your forecast, confidence, and reasoning at execution—review monthly to identify emotional patterns.
